Foodservice Supervisor
Plum Market – Columbus Airport
Description:
The Foodservice Supervisor supports the General Manager in executing the day-to-day operations of Plum Market’s foodservice outlets at the Columbus Airport. This leadership role provides hands-on support across all roles and departments, ensuring service excellence, product quality, and operational compliance. The Supervisor sets the standard for team accountability, safety, and hospitality, while acting as a reliable point of contact for both Guests and Team Members.

What you will bring:
Experience in a supervisory or keyholder role within foodservice, retail, or hospitality.
Working knowledge of food safety, sanitation, and basic health department standards.
Strong time-management and communication skills.
Ability to lead by example, provide coaching, and support daily performance.
Familiarity with inventory practices, timekeeping systems, and basic cash handling procedures.
Ability to work flexible shifts, including nights, weekends, and holidays.
Physical ability to stand and walk for up to 4 hours without a break.
Ability to bend and stoop to grasp objects, climb ladders, lift up to 50 lbs. unassisted, and push/pull carts weighing up to 100 lbs. unassisted.
What you will do:
Oversee day-to-day foodservice operations, ensuring Guest satisfaction and team efficiency.
Support all functional roles across the operation (register, food prep, service, stocking, etc.).
Maintain inventory control processes and ensure accurate receiving and storage of products.
Monitor time & attendance and assist with staff scheduling.
Participate in employee training, development, and coaching.
Assist with cash management duties including counting drawers and depositing funds into the safe.
Conduct knife audits and promote food safety best practices.
Support merchandising and restocking of retail and grab-and-go displays to Plum Market standards.
Address and report product quality issues to kitchen staff and the GM.
Transport product between units as needed within the airport.
Participate in interviews and assist with new hire onboarding.
Serve as the Manager on Duty during opening and/or closing shifts.
